.v-align-middle{vertical-align:middle !important}.table-info{border:1px solid #333}.table-metadata td{border:1px solid #888 !important;width:50%;padding:3px 10px;font-size:12px}.stock-header .stock-image{background-color:#f3f3f3;width:60px;height:60px;border-radius:10px;margin:5px 25px}.text-title{font-weight:bold}.stock-header .stock-image-wrapper{margin-left:22px}.stock-header .sku-text{color:#000;margin-bottom:0;margin-top:12px}.stock-header .page-action-container{padding-top:15px}.stock-branch .stock-branch-header{color:#333;margin:10px 0 20px}.stock-branch .stock-branch-header .fa{color:#b5b5c3;margin-right:15px}.stock-branch .summary-table{max-width:100%;width:250px;margin:10px}.stock-branch .summary-table td{border:1px solid #ccc;font-size:11px;padding:3px 10px}.stock-branch .summary-table td.summary-title{width:70%;font-weight:bold;color:#333;text-transform:capitalize}.stock-branch .summary-table td.summary-value{width:30%;text-align:right}.model-selection{margin-top:15px}.ratio-display{font-size:30px}.ratio-display span{margin-right:15px}.model-detail{background:#f3f3f3;padding:12px;border-radius:6px}.table-batch{margin-bottom:0;background:#efefef}.table-batch td{padding-top:0;padding-bottom:0}.table-batch td input{width:100%}.sub-row{border-left:1px dashed #000;padding-left:5px}.sub-row-wrapper{max-height:250px;overflow-y:auto}.cart-stock-name{width:45%}.cart-stock-name a{font-weight:600;color:#676a6c}.stock-header.page-heading{padding-bottom:0}.po-details-wrapper{float:left;width:100%;overflow:hidden}.expander-handler{margin-bottom:15px}.po-status-title{color:#485663;letter-spacing:1px;font-size:10px;font-weight:bold;text-transform:uppercase}.po-status-value{font-weight:bold;font-size:20px;color:#333;margin-bottom:5px;transition:all .3s;display:inline-block}.po-status{padding-left:15px;border-left:3px solid #333;cursor:pointer;display:inline-block}.po-status-help{font-size:12px;display:none}.po-status:hover .po-status-help{display:block !important}.po-status:hover .po-status-value{background-color:#333;color:#fff;padding:5px 15px;border-radius:25px;margin-top:5px}tr.top-header th{border-bottom:none !important;padding:5px !important}tr.top-header th.qty-header{border-bottom:2px solid #333 !important;color:#333;font-size:11px}table.table-std tr:not(.top-header) th,tr.bottom-header th{border-top:none !important;border-bottom:2px solid #333 !important;padding:5px !important;color:#333;font-size:11px;background:#f7f7f7}tr.top-header th.highlight{border-bottom:2px solid #333 !important;color:#333;font-size:11px}tr th.qty-highlight{background-color:#eee}tr td.qty-highlight{background-color:#eee}.summary-footer{border-top:1px solid #333;border-bottom:4px double #333;background-color:#fafafa;font-weight:bold}.supplier-payment-print{margin-top:50px;padding:20px 0 100px 0;margin-bottom:50px;page-break-after:always}.image-gallery-item-container{position:relative;width:200px;height:200px;border:1px solid #dfdfdf;padding:10px;border-radius:1rem}.image-gallery-item-container-image{width:150px;height:150px;margin:auto}.image-gallery-item-container-image img:hover{cursor:pointer;transform:scale(1.1)}.image-gallery-item-x{position:absolute;right:10px;cursor:pointer;color:#818181c4}.image-fit{height:100%;width:100%;object-fit:contain;transition:transform cubic-bezier(.4,0,.2,1) 450ms}.multi-item-uploader-item-container{width:50px;height:50px}.multi-item-uploader-item-icon-size{font-size:30px}